On Wednesday’s edition of Zolak & Bertrand, the crew constructed the path to Christian McCaffrey landing with the Patriots.

  • It's all possible because you're not paying the QB

    Beetle: By the way, he’s (Christian McCaffrey) 26 years old. He’s not very old. I know he’s had an injury and he’s back now, but he’s not old. Base salary next year, $11.8 MM. Same in ’24 and then $12 MM in ’25.

    Zo: You’re not paying them that. See the problem is you have no replacement for James White right now. You have no third-down back. You have no third-down back offense. You don’t have that scat back. You don’t have that guy, that stout that could blitz pick up and, you know, sort of run those little man to man shake routes.

    Beetle: From what I see in this deal, it’d be easy to cut him for year three of that. Of those next three years, you could get through the next two years and then cut him. And there’s not a big penalty for doing so.

    Zo: The only way you could still do is because you’re still not paying the quarterback.
